STATE v. ROMERO

070833871; A138124.

237 P.3d 894 (2010)

236 Or. App. 640

STATE of Oregon, Plaintiff-Respondent, v. Ernesto Alexander ROMERO, Defendant-Appellant.

Court of Appeals of Oregon.

Decided August 18, 2010.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Ryan T. O'Connor, Deputy Public Defender, argued the cause for appellant. With him on the brief was Peter Gartlan, Chief Defender, Office of Public Defense Services.

David B. Thompson, Senior Assistant Attorney General, argued the cause for respondent. With him on the brief were John R. Kroger, Attorney General, and Jerome Lidz, Solicitor General.

Before WOLLHEIM, Presiding Judge, and BREWER, Chief Judge, and SERCOMBE, Judge.


BREWER, C.J.

Defendant appeals his convictions for unlawful use of a vehicle and possession of a stolen vehicle.
